10 Facts About Lin Whitworth

1.

Arthur Lin Whitworth was a Democratic county commissioner from Bannock County, Idaho.

2.

Lin Whitworth previously served in the Idaho State Senate and was a candidate for the United States House of Representatives in 2004.

3.

Arthur Lin Whitworth was born in Inkom, Idaho, a small town near Pocatello, Idaho.

4.

Lin Whitworth went to the Inkom Elementary and Inkom High Schools.

5.

Lin Whitworth was reelected in 1996,1998 and 2000 but resigned midway through his fourth term.

6.

Lin Whitworth served in very small Democratic minorities in the Idaho Senate, and was one of only three Democrats in the body as of his 2001 resignation.
